Costa Nova

A visit to the truely unique Costa Nova beach is a must, where you can admire the vast expanse of golden sand and blue water. Also, take note of the palheiros – pretty wooden houses painted in candy stripes – which give Costa Nova a distinctive, colourful quality, adding character to the whole area.

We can recommend eating at Peixe Na Costa. 'The restaurant is located a a short walk from the main strip,but it's definitely worth the 10 minute walk. Everything is prepared freshly local produce. The specialty is fish with the fish cataplana near perfection.'

Aveiro

Uncover the captivating charm of the “Venice of Portugal”, Aveiro is a small town boasting winding canals and quaint whitewashed houses. It is worth taking a  on a Moliceiro (traditional canal boat) to learn about its history and culture from your guide.  Absorb the rich maritime heritage of delightful bridges and enchanting pathways as you're taken to the charming Old Quarter. Wander through meandering streets and pass by notable landmarks, including the Cathedral of Aveiro and the Church of St John the Evangelist.

We can recommend eating at Tasca do Sal. 'Tasca do Sal  is a charming little tapas bar overlooking the main waterway. We had the Pratas do Dia: a squid and white bean stew, slow cooked overnight and skewered chicken, moist chargrilled and wrapped in smoky bacon. The fish is so fresh you can see the market where it was purchased. '

Arouca Geopark

The Geopark is a  short drive to Arouca village, The hiking trails are well signposted,  head for the wooden stairs to photograph the amazing canyon and the agricultural fields. Below is the river  with pleasantly cool  little waterfalls and lots of beautiful shimmering pebbles and quartz. 

We can recommend taking walking shoes and sun hats!
